Marwari (Marvadi) culture is globally renowned for its grand weddings, deep-rooted family values, and sharp business acumen. However, beneath the public spectacle of multi-day celebrations lies a fascinating, evolving ecosystem of personal relationships and romantic narratives. From the historical folklore of Rajasthan to modern-day digital matchmaking, Marwari romance balances intense community obligations with the universal desire for personal connection. In Marvadi households, love is often expressed through food. A wife preparing her husband’s favorite Dal Baati Churma or packing a special lunch for his long day at the office is a meaningful sign of affection.
